SPARTAN NOTES: In her fourth season with the Spartans...one of three team tri-captains...Academic All-WAC honoree in 2005-06 and 2006-07...2004-05 and 2005-06 San Jose State University “Scholar-Athlete.”
2006: Appeared in 15 games, starting five straight in central defense between the home match with Notre Dame de Namur (9/15) and the contest at UC Irvine (10/1)...credited with 10 shots, two on goal...season high was three shots at Utah State (10/13)...earned the team’s “Circuit Award,” given to the individual who best exemplifies the spirit of Spartan women’s soccer.
2005: Played in 12 games, earning a start at Sacramento State (9/25)...assisted on the final goal of the 4-2 home win over Utah State (10/14) for first collegiate point...took 11 shots, with five on goal.
2004: Played in four games and started once...collegiate debut came at home against IUPUI (9/3)...first college start and shot came against California (9/12) in Moraga, Calif.
SAN LORENZO VALLEY HIGH SCHOOL: Lettered in soccer three seasons at San Lorenzo Valley High School in Felton, Calif....named the 2003 Santa Cruz Coast Athletic League “Co-Midfielder of the Year” along with current teammate Brittny Beshore...named her team’s “Most Valuable Player” as a senior...two-time first-team all-league selection.
HEIDI: Journalism major...would like to do some traveling after college before finding a job...enjoys photography and bowling...played club soccer for the SCC Magic, SCC Mirage, De Anza Sharks and Pleasanton Rage...father, Art Romswinckel, was an All-America selection in soccer at San Jose State in 1969, and is a member of the school’s Sports Hall of Fame...has six siblings...Heidi Romswinckel-Guise, born in Santa Cruz, Calif., will be 21 years old during the 2007 season.
